Output bf90b27ba23f3914d554a044bbbcf12ad0909d7aa340e5057d099ae5cf3ed34a:1

value
102248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73c0ae40395144eb1000aac979b863cd0ea8b2c2 OP_EQUAL
address
3CF4THsdmKAXhUBRFWovnpQVbfQg486czS
transaction
bf90b27ba23f3914d554a044bbbcf12ad0909d7aa340e5057d099ae5cf3ed34a
confirmations
45912
spent
true